dont waste time teaching single note versions of song melodies unless you are using them as ear training where the student has to figure them out and prove that they are 'getting it' when it comes to learning by ear

teach em chords ... open position cowboy chords ... then root on 6th and root on 5th ... make em learn the notes on the neck for those two strings ...

use simple songs to get the ability to change chords on the beat down pat
